Following the dismissal of Roberto Martinez towards the end of the 2015/2016 season, Everton have remained without a head coach till now.

Despite reports that they had agreed terms with Southampton boss, Ronald Koeman, the Toffees were locked in a compensation battle with Southampton.

Everton will now pay £5m in compensation as Koeman will now leave the Saints where he has managed and achieved impressive results in two years.

Everton’s new owner Farhad Moshiri had little patience for Martinez’s dismal second season and now look to Koeman who guided Southampton to sixth and seventh place finishes in his two seasons to chart a new course.
